Subject: Quickstore 4.2 — bloom filter now fronts the KV layer

Plugin authors: starting with this release, Quickstore places a bloom filter ahead of the key-value store. Negative lookups return faster; false positives fall through safely. No API changes are required on your side. Verify your plugin against the staging build referenced below.

session token of fahif-tadup = htk3_9c7

Hi on-call folks,

Quick recap: the Crumbport bakery platform now enforces the new order-cutoff rule. Orders placed after the cutoff roll to the next fulfillment day automatically — no more manual shuffling by the Larkhollow kitchen staff. We flipped the flag at 06:00, watched two cutoff windows, and saw zero misrouted orders. If anything looks off tonight, the cutoff logic lives in the scheduler service, not the storefront. For reference, here are the values the service is running with:

settings of tagef-bawif:
DRUIX_HOST=druix.zemvarlabs.internal
DRUIX_PORT=8000

- [ ] Confirm bucket hashing unchanged vs. prior release (golden-file test green).
- [ ] Verify sticky assignments survive restart on staging.
- [ ] Check exposure logging emits one event per subject, no dupes.
- [ ] Kill-switch tested: all experiments fall back to control within 30s.
- [ ] Dashboards reviewed with Delia before cutover.

No schema migrations this cycle. Rollback is a straight redeploy of the previous artifact. Release manager signs off only after the token below matches the staging deploy.

session token of yajof-bagef = htk4_937d